Who is Forrest Myers?
Forrest W. Myers is an American sculptor. He is best known for his 1969 "Moon Museum" and 1973 "The Wall" pieces, a monumental wall sculpture in SoHo, New York.
Myers studied at the San Francisco Art Institute from 1958 to 1960 and moved to New York in 1961. He currently lived and works in Brooklyn, NY and Damascus, Pa.
